Onboarding — digest scheduling. Quornely batch email digests run from the Saltmere scheduler, not cron. Edit windows in the scheduler UI only; config files are overwritten nightly. Digests queue at :05 past the hour and send in tenant order. If the scheduler locks after a failed deploy, open the recovery prompt on the primary node and enter the passphrase below.

vault phrase of kafog-kahif = holdor-rusir-praox

Subject: Quickstore 4.2 — bloom filter now fronts the KV layer

Plugin authors: starting with this release, Quickstore places a bloom filter ahead of the key-value store. Negative lookups return faster; false positives fall through safely. No API changes are required on your side. Verify your plugin against the staging build referenced below.

session token of fahif-tadup = htk3_9c7

### FeedCheck returns "schema fetch failed" on all validations

This usually means the Podrell schema registry is unreachable or the validator's credentials expired. Check registry health first; if it's up, the token is the culprit — they rotate every 30 days and the cron that refreshes them fails silently if the config volume is read-only. Remount, rerun the refresh job, and re-validate a known-good feed to confirm. For manual verification against staging, send requests with the bearer token below.

portal login ticket: eyJhbGciOiJIUzI1NiIsInR5cCI6IkpXVCJ9.eyJzdWIiOiIwEOsktwVNwIn0.-UJU3fdyyCgG

Subject: Hookrelay cut-over summary — retry semantics

For your review: we completed the cut-over of webhook delivery to the new Hookrelay dispatcher this morning. Retries now use capped exponential backoff with jitter instead of fixed intervals, and terminal failures move to a dead-letter table rather than being dropped. Please verify the backoff math in the dispatcher module against the deployed settings, which follow below.

settings of bafof-fajog:
[aldix]
port = 9300
region = north-3
host = aldix.kelvilabs.example
team = istath
timeout_ms = 1500
retries = 8